I hear & sometimes see coyotes in the heart of Scenic Safford. They tend to follow the railroad tracks thru town; access to pet food, stray cats, water & cover. Most people just mistake them for half grown German Shepherds running loose. Actually, a pretty good set-up.

There was a recent article in, I believe The Gila Herald about a sow bear & cubs sighted in town.
Javelina in the shrubbery are not unknown, either.

Well, it should have been obvious but lately while driving and dropping my daughter off at ONT airport, There is a railroad track that runs right next to the airport property. It’s a great little island in the middle of the city yet isolated and lots of cover for coyotes. I don’t know why that obvious shelter escaped my observation, but it did until recently. Actually, there is a huge switching facility in nearby Colton and I bet coyotes have staked it out. But, it’s an open secret that airport grounds are practically coyote central with lots of rabbits. They are all over the place after dark and here come the coyotes that easily outrun the rabbits. It’s a perfect ecosystem, just about as perfect as any golf course. In fact, I know that there are people that are contracted to thin out the coyote population in and around Griffith Park where there is the observatory and the Zoo and a golf course. That combo is guaranteed to raise bumper crops of coyotes every season. I know one of the guys that used to do it very late at night with tiny tiney 17 caliber suppressed rifles. Don’t know if he still does, but somebody does; kind of confidential, the weak misinformed ladies around town would not approve.
